As far as installation, it depends on several factors.

There are two types. the kind that plug in to a wall outlet, and the kind that get wired in by an electrician.
If you go for the wired in kind, you may have to hire an electrician even if you're qualified to do it yourself. (depends on your local codes and laws)
If you go for the plug-in kind you may have to have an electrician install a wall outlet in your wall (depends on how your home is wired, your landlord, and other factors I might be forgetting)
